Sergey Sharybin
981ab904ba Merge branch 'blender-v4.3-release' 2024-10-31 16:05:22 +01:00
Alaska
c2f93e0f68 Cycles: Remove support for Vega in Cycles AMD HIP backend
This commit removes support for Vega GPUs from the AMD HIP backend of
Cycles. This is being done as:
- AMD no longer provides official support for Vega GPUs in their
ROCm software.
- Vega GPUs have rendering artifacts on all supported platforms,
and as a result of the reduction of support from AMD, are unlikely
to be fixed. Rendering artifacts include.
  - The incorrect shading of volumes (Windows and Linux)
  - Missing intersections on many meshes with HIPRT
  - Crashing rendering subsurface scattering materials (Linux)
  - And more.

Sahar A. Kashi
26ed4d3892 Cycles: Linux Support for HIP-RT
This change switches Cycles to an opensource HIP-RT library which
implements hardware ray-tracing. This library is now used on
both Windows and Linux. While there should be no noticeable changes
on Windows, on Linux this adds support for hardware ray-tracing on
AMD GPUs.

The majority of the change is typical platform code to add new
library to the dependency builder, and a change in the way how
ahead-of-time (AoT) kernels are compiled. There are changes in
Cycles itself, but they are rather straightforward: some APIs
changed in the opensource version of the library.

There are a couple of extra files which are needed for this to
work: hiprt02003_6.1_amd.hipfb and oro_compiled_kernels.hipfb.
There are some assumptions in the HIP-RT library about how they
are available. Currently they follow the same rule as AoT
kernels for oneAPI:
- On Windows they are next to blender.exe
- On Linux they are in the lib/ folder

Performance comparison on Ubuntu 22.04.5:
```
GPU: AMD Radeon PRO W7800
Driver: amdgpu-install_6.1.60103-1_all.deb
                       main         hip-rt
attic                  0.1414s      0.0932s
barbershop_interior    0.1563s      0.1258s
bistro                 0.2134s      0.1597s
bmw27                  0.0119s      0.0099s
classroom              0.1006s      0.0803s
fishy_cat              0.0248s      0.0178s
junkshop               0.0916s      0.0713s
koro                   0.0589s      0.0720s
monster                0.0435s      0.0385s
pabellon               0.0543s      0.0391s
sponza                 0.0223s      0.0180s
spring                 0.1026s      1.5145s
victor                 0.1901s      0.1239s
wdas_cloud             0.1153s      0.1125s
```

Jeroen Bakker
d3034ac54e Vulkan: Enable in a regular release
The Vulkan backend has come a long way and it is time to spread his
wings a bit more. This change will make the vulkan backend available
in a regular release starting from 4.3.

Vulkan is still experimental and performance isn't there yet. But it
gives add-on developers already time to check if their add-ons work.
Main goal for the vulkan project is to get a better understanding which
platforms are supported.

- NVIDIA GTX900 and up should be supported using the official NVIDIA
  drivers. This means that support for GTX700/800 is currently not
  available. This is related to dynamic rendering.
- AMD Polaris and up are supported using the AMD drivers. When using
  the open source drivers I believe the support level is around GCN2.
- Intel CPUs are supported from UHD (6th gen) on Linux. On windows
  it requires features that are not available on all latest drivers and
  a workaround should be added on our side.
- Intel GPUs are supported preferrable using the latest drivers on
  Windows and Linux

Some render artifacts are showing when using EEVEE but the cause is
clear and would assume to solve them before the actual release.

Jacques Lucke
bb8460da9e Tests: support generating code coverage report
This only works with GCC and has only been tested on Linux. The main goal is to
automatically generate the code coverage reports on the buildbot and to publish
them. With some luck, this motivates people to increase test coverage in their
respective areas. Nevertheless, it should be easy to generate the reports
locally too (at least on supported software stacks).

Usage:
1. Create a **debug** build using **GCC** with **WITH_COMPILER_CODE_COVERAGE**
   enabled.
2. Run tests. This automatically generates `.gcda` files in the build directory.
3. Run `make/ninja coverage-report` in the build directory.

If everything is successful, this will open a browser with the final report
which is stored in `build-dir/coverage/report/`. For a bit more control one can
also run `coverage.py` script directly. This allows passing in the
`--no-browser` option which may be benefitial when running it on the buildbot.
Running `make/ninja coverage-reset` deletes all `.gcda` files which resets the
line execution counts.

The final report has a main entry point (`index.html`) and a separate `.html`
file for every source code file that coverage data was available for. This also
contains some code that is not in Blender's git repository. We could filter
those out, but it also seems interesting (to me anyway), so I just kept it in.

Doing the analysis and writing the report takes ~1 min. The slow part is running
all tests in a debug build which takes ~12 min for me. Since the coverage data
is fairly large and the report also includes the entire source code, file
compression is used in two places:
* The intermediate analysis results for each file are stored in compressed zip
  files. This data is still independent from the report html and could be used
  to build other tools on top of. I could imagine storing the analysis data for
  each day for example to gather greater insights into how coverage changes over
  time in different parts of the code.
* The analysis data and source code is compressed and base64 encoded embedded
  into the `.html` files. This makes them much smaller than embedding the data
  without compression (5-10x).

Jesse Yurkovich
ec4fc2d34a CMake: Modernize the optional TBB dependency
This continues the cmake modernization effort and introduces support for
allowing our optional dependencies to integrate properly. TBB is added
here as it's proven troublesome to maintain correctly.

Currently the only Blender project which uses the TBB headers directly
is `blenlib`.  However, all downstream projects which require blenlib as
their dependency, and wish to properly make use of its threading
facilities, needed to define various TBB items in their CMake files. Not
only is this unnecessary and arcane, but several projects didn't do this
and ended up not using threading as well as producing ODR violations
along the way[1].

This PR makes TBB a modern dependency and exposes it PUBLIC'ly from
`blenlib`.  All downstream projects which depend on blenlib will now
receive everything they require from TBB automatically. This includes
the `WITH_TBB` define, the headers, and the library itself.

Omar Emara
d4bf23771d Compositor: Optimize Fog Glow Glare node
This patches optimizes the Fog Glow Glare node to be about 25x faster
for 4K images. This is mainly achieved by utilizing the FFTW library and
multi-threading support code. Further improvements are still possible by
caching kernels, but the CPU compositor does not support caching yet.

The old Hartley transform was removed, so the node no longer works when
FFTW is disabled as a build time option, much like the OIDN node. A new
BLI library was introduced for FFTW, it includes some helper routines
relevant for FFTW as well as an initialization routine that sets up
multithreading using TBB as well as thread safety.

Build system support for threaded FFTW was also added, which defines the
relevant variables to detect threading support as well as add the
relevant libraries.

We do not currently have the threaded FFTW libs in our precompiled libs,
so the threading code is disabled until the libs lands in the coming
weeks. So currently, the code is only about 9x faster.

The only functional change is that the kernel is now odd sized, which
should produce more accurate results, but the final result is almost
identical and mostly undetectable.

The plan is to port this to the GPU as well similar to how we implement
OIDN until we have a GPU FFT implementation. GPU compositor can also do
caching, so it should be faster, being able to compute a 4K image in
under half a second.
